Not to be snarky, but you care about weight on a 750+ lb bike?? I have had lots of carbon fiber exhausts. As long as you dont store them in the direct sun, don't run super lean and don't wash with harsh chemicals they will last a long time.
Also stock is too large. When choosing your carbon fibre slip-ons, you might want to consider if they allow you access to the rear axle without having to remove them.

I have Agostinis on my 1400 and one of my riding buddies has Mistrals on his.IMHO each brand has a distinctive sound:- Agostinis have what I describe as a 'bark' when you blip the throttle.- Mistrals have more of a deep rumble.I rather like the way Mistrals sound but prefer the look of Agostinis.
